Why It’s Important to Find Local House Painters You Can Trust


Choosing local painters has many benefits. They understand the climate and conditions in Sydney, which affects paint durability and colour choices. Plus, local painters are more accessible for consultations, follow-ups, and any touch-ups you might need later.


When you find local house painters, you’re supporting your community and often get quicker, more personalised service. It’s reassuring to know the team working on your home is nearby and invested in their reputation.


Here’s what I look for when searching for painters near me:


  • Experience and expertise in residential or commercial painting

  • Positive customer reviews and testimonials

  • Proper licensing and insurance

  • Clear, detailed quotes and contracts

  • Friendly, professional communication


Taking the time to check these details upfront saves headaches later.

How to Find Local House Painters Who Match Your Needs


Finding the right painters starts with a bit of research. I recommend starting online and then narrowing down your options with phone calls or meetings.


  1. Search online for “house painters near me” to get a list of local professionals. For example, you can check out house painters near me for trusted options in Sydney.

  2. Read reviews on Google, Facebook, or local directories. Look for consistent praise about quality, punctuality, and professionalism.

  3. Ask for recommendations from friends, family, or neighbours who have recently had painting done.

  4. Check portfolios on painters’ websites or social media to see their previous work.

  5. Contact at least three painters to discuss your project, get quotes, and gauge their communication style.


When you speak with painters, ask about their process, the types of paint they use, and how they handle prep work. A good painter will be happy to explain everything clearly.

How Much Does It Cost for a Painter to Paint a Whole House?


One of the first questions I always ask is about cost. Painting a whole house can vary widely depending on size, condition, and paint quality. Here’s a rough breakdown to help you budget:


  • Small homes or apartments: $3,000 - $6,000

  • Medium-sized houses: $6,000 - $12,000

  • Large homes or multi-storey: $12,000 and up


These prices usually include:


  • Surface preparation (cleaning, sanding, filling holes)

  • Primer and paint

  • Labour and equipment

  • Clean-up


Keep in mind, premium paints or special finishes will increase the cost. Also, if your walls need repairs or mould treatment, that adds to the price.


Always ask for a detailed quote that breaks down the costs. This helps you compare fairly and avoid surprises.


What to Look for in a Painting Contract and Warranty


Once you’ve chosen your painter, the next step is signing a contract. This document protects both you and the painter by clearly outlining the scope of work, timelines, and payment terms.


Here’s what I make sure to see in every painting contract:


  • Start and completion dates so you know when to expect the job done

  • Detailed description of work including surfaces, paint brands, and colours

  • Payment schedule with deposit and final payment terms

  • Warranty or guarantee on workmanship and paint durability

  • Cleanup and disposal responsibilities


A warranty is a sign of confidence. It means the painter stands behind their work and will fix any issues that arise within a certain period.


If anything in the contract is unclear, don’t hesitate to ask questions or request changes. It’s your home, and you deserve clarity.


Tips for Preparing Your Home Before the Painters Arrive


Getting your home ready can make the painting process smoother and faster. Here are some simple steps I follow:


  • Move furniture away from walls or cover it with drop cloths

  • Remove wall hangings, curtains, and switch plates

  • Clear outdoor areas if exterior painting is planned

  • Make sure pets and children are safe and out of the way

  • Communicate any special requests or concerns to your painter


Good preparation helps painters focus on their work and reduces the risk of accidents or damage.
